The Pinefare points ledger is the source of truth for every member's balance. Support agents can view entries but never edit them directly — all corrections go through the adjustment tool, which writes a signed compensating entry. If a customer reports a missing accrual, check the pending queue first; accruals can take up to two hours to post after a purchase. Manual adjustments above 5,000 points require lead approval. The adjustment workflow, approval rules, and common ledger states are documented on the internal page.

wiki page, yawig-haweg: https://confluence.lumicsys.internal/pages/pages/projects/pages

## Changelog — v4.2.1 (Haulstone Fleet Analytics)

Renamed setting: FUEL_REPORT_WINDOW is now FUEL_USAGE_LOOKBACK_DAYS to match the other fleet report variables. The old name is still read with a deprecation warning until v4.4, after which it is ignored. Default remains 30 days; the Merrivale depot pilot runs at 7. Release manager note: deployment scripts that template the env file must update the key name in the same pass that rotates the reporting credential, which the env file sets on the following line.

vault entry, yajop-bafop: ARCHIVE_KEY3=8d4

## Authentication

The Velvetrow seat-map renderer requires a bearer token on every request to `/v2/seatmaps`. Tokens are issued by the Curtaincall identity service and carry a `venue` claim that must match the theatre being rendered; mismatches return 403 with a `VENUE_SCOPE` error code. Tokens expire after 24 hours, and the renderer does not refresh them automatically, so support staff should re-issue rather than retry. When reproducing a customer issue in the sandbox, authenticate using the token provided below.

session JWT of yawep-yawep = eyJhbGciOiJIUzI1NiIsInR5cCI6IkpXVCJ9.eyJzdWIiOiI3pWF3_In0.aXYsHiog